What is the recommended minimum time for a lunch break on a long ride?

Taking a break during a long ride is important for maintaining focus and ensuring safety. A minimum of one hour is generally recommended for a lunch break. This duration allows you to properly rest, hydrate, and refuel, preventing fatigue that can accumulate during extended periods of riding. A break of this length gives you sufficient time to step away from the motorcycle, enjoy a meal, stretch your legs, and relax mentally before getting back on the road.

Shorter breaks might not provide adequate recovery time, potentially leading to diminished concentration and increased risk of accidents. Conversely, much longer breaks can disrupt the flow of a trip, making it less efficient. Therefore, one hour strikes a balance between recovery and maintaining ride momentum, making it the optimal choice for long rides.
